ABSTRACT

INTRODUCTION: Older patients with cancer range from fit to frail with various comorbidities and resilience to chemotherapy. Besides nausea and fatigue, a significant number of patients experience dizziness and impaired walking balance after chemotherapy, which can have great impact on their functional ability and health related quality of life. Symptoms are easily overlooked and therefore often underreported and managed, which is why symptoms could end up as long-lasting side effects. The aim of this study is to investigate the development of dizziness, decline in walking balance, and sarcopenia and the effect of a comprehensive geriatric assessment and 12 weeks of group-based exercise on these symptoms. The exercise intervention includes vestibular and balance exercises, and progressive resistance training, to counteract the symptoms in older patients with colorectal cancer treated with chemotherapy. MATERIALS AND METHODS: This is a randomized controlled trial including patients ≥65 years initiating (neo)adjuvant or first-line palliative chemotherapy for colorectal cancer. Patients will undergo a comprehensive assessment program including measures of vestibular function, balance, muscle strength, mass, and endurance, peripheral and autonomic nerve function, and subjective measures of dizziness, concern of falling, and health related quality of life. Tests will be performed at baseline, 12, and 24 weeks. Patients will be placed in three different randomized controlled trials depending on chemotherapy regimen and randomized 1:1 to comprehensive geriatric assessment and exercise three times/week or control. Participants in both groups will continue with usual care, including standardized oncological treatment. In total, 150 patients are needed to assess the two primary outcomes of (1) maintenance of walking balance assessed with Dynamic Gait Index and (2) lower limb strength and endurance assessed with 30 Second Sit-to-Stand Test at 12 weeks. The primary outcomes will be analyzed using a mixed linear regression model investigating the between-group differences. DISCUSSION: Trial enrollment began in April 2023 and is the first trial to evaluate reasons for dizziness, decline in walking balance, and sarcopenia in older patients receiving chemotherapy. The trial will provide new and valuable knowledge in how to assess, manage, and prevent dizziness, decline in walking balance, and sarcopenia in older patients with colorectal cancer. TRIAL REGISTRATION: The Regional Ethics Committee (j.nr. H-22064206). Danish Data Protection Agency (P-2023-86) and ClinicalTrials.gov (NCT05710809).

ABSTRACT

INTRODUCTION: Radical surgery combined with chemotherapy is the only potential curative treatment of patients with advanced epithelial ovarian cancer (EOC). However, 43% of older Danish patients with EOC are not referred to surgery due to frailty, age, or fear of complications. Comprehensive geriatric assessment (CGA) has demonstrated ability to reduce frailty in older patients, but there is a knowledge gap regarding its effect before or during treatment in older adults with EOC. This protocol presents a randomized controlled trial (RCT), which evaluates the effect of CGA-based interventions including individualized physical exercise therapy in older adults with EOC during neoadjuvant chemotherapy (NACT). MATERIALS AND METHODS: This RCT will include patients aged ≥70 years with primary EOC referred to NACT. Patients will be randomized 1:1 to intervention or standard of care, along with neoadjuvant antineoplastic treatment. Stratification for performance status and center of inclusion will be performed. In the intervention arm, a geriatrician will perform CGA and corresponding geriatric interventions and patients will undergo an individualized home-based exercise program managed by a physiotherapist. All patients will be evaluated with Geriatric-8, modified Geriatric-8, clinical frailty scale, and physical tests at randomization. Predictive values (positive/negative) will be evaluated for CGA detected impairments. The primary endpoint is the proportion of patients referred to interval debulking surgery (IDS). Secondary endpoints include the proportion who complete oncological treatment, improvements in physical tests, quality of life measured by European Organization for Research and Treatment of Cancer-Quality of Life questionnaires at inclusion, after three cycles of chemotherapy, and at end of chemotherapy treatment. Furthermore, the association between results of geriatric screening tests, CGA, and physical tests with complication rate and progression free survival will be examined. The primary outcome will be analyzed with logistic regression in the intention-to-treat population. Power calculations reveal the need to enroll 216 patients. DISCUSSION: The present study examines whether CGA-based interventions including individualized physical exercise can increase the referral rate for potential curative IDS in older patients with EOC. If successful, this will result in more patients undergoing surgery and completing chemotherapy, preventing complications, and ultimately improving quality of life and survival. The study setup may establish the basis for direct clinical implementation if proven effective.

ABSTRACT

Frailty in older patients with cancer increases the risk of treatment related toxicity, mortality, physical decline, and quality of life. This review summarises various screening tools. Screening tools identifying frailty serve multiple purposes, providing awareness of health issues impacting oncologic treatment and prognosis and facilitating the delivery of a Comprehensive Geriatric Assessment (CGA). CGA is an overall health assessment and treatment targeting frailty. Providing CGA to older patients with cancer reduces the risk of toxicity and functional decline, increases treatment completion, and prevents loss of quality of life.

ABSTRACT

INTRODUCTION: Older patients with frailty starting oncological treatment are at higher risk of experiencing declining physical performance, loss of independence, and quality of life (QoL). This study examines whether comprehensive geriatric assessment (CGA)-guided interventions added to standard oncological care can prevent declining physical performance and QoL in older patients with frailty initiating palliative treatment. MATERIALS AND METHODS: Patients aged ≥70 years, with a Geriatric-8 score of ≤14, initiating palliative oncological treatment were enrolled in an open label randomized controlled trial and randomized 1:1 to receive either CGA-guided interventions in addition to oncological standard care or oncological care alone. Baseline characteristics, physical performance measures, and QoL questionnaires were retrieved before group allocation. CGA was performed using a fixed set of domains and validated tests by a geriatrician-led team. The primary endpoint, physical performance, was measured by the 30-s chair stand test (30s-CST) at three months. Additional outcomes included 30s-CST at six months, handgrip strength test, and QoL. Outcomes were analyzed using linear mixed regression models. The trial was registered at clinicaltrials.org (NCT04686851). RESULTS: From November 1, 2020 to May 31, 2022, 181 patients were included; 88 in the interventional arm and 93 in the control arm. Median age was 77 (interquartile range [IQR] 73-81) years, 69% were male, median Geriatric-8 score was 12 (IQR 10-13), 69% had a Performance Status of 0-1, and the median 30s-CST was 9 (IQR 5-11) repetitions. The between-group difference in 30s-CST at three months was 0.67 (95%CI: -0.94 - 2.29) and 1.57 (95%CI: -0.20 - 3.34) at six months, which were not statistically significant. Subgroup analysis including participants with a baseline Geriatric-8 of 12-14 found borderline significant between-group differences in 30s-CST scores at three and six months of 2.04 (95% confidence interval [CI]: -0.07 - 4.2, P = 0.06) and 2.25 (95%CI: 0.01-4.5, P = 0.05), respectively. No within-group or between-group differences in the summary score or the Elderly Functional Index score (measuring QoL) were found. DISCUSSION: This study did not find significant between-group differences in the 30s-CST in older patients receiving palliative care. However, a tendency towards improved physical performance was seen in the least frail. These patients may represent a target group wherein CGA interventions provide particular benefit.

ABSTRACT

INTRODUCTION: Aging is often associated with low-grade chronic inflammation and a senescent immune system. Vitamin D is a regulator of immune function, and low plasma vitamin D is associated with poor health. The association between plasma vitamin D and inflammatory biomarkers and risk of postoperative complications and survival in patients with colorectal cancer (CRC) is unknown. Our aim was to investigate these associations and how they are influenced by age. MATERIALS AND METHODS: Circulating vitamin D and the inflammatory biomarkers C-reactive protein (CRP), interleukin (IL)-6, and YKL-40 were measured in 398 patients with stage I-III CRC preoperatively. Older patients (≥70 years, n = 208) were compared to younger patients (<70 years, n = 190). The relation between vitamin D and complications and high inflammatory biomarker levels was presented by odds ratios ([OR], 95% confidence interval [CI]). Associations with survival were presented with hazard ratios ([HR], 95% CI). RESULTS: Plasma vitamin D was higher in older patients than in younger patients (75 vs. 67 nmol/L, P = 0.001). High vitamin D was associated with low plasma CRP in younger patients (OR = 0.35, 95% CI 0.17-0.76), but not in older patients (OR = 0.93, 0.49-1.76). High vitamin D in older patients with CRC was associated with reduced risk of major complications (OR = 0.52, 0.28-0.95). This was not found in younger patients (OR = 1.47, 0.70-3.11). Deficient vitamin D (<25 nmol/L) was associated with short overall survival compared to sufficient (>50 nmol/L) irrespective of age (HR = 3.39, 1.27-9.37, P = 0.02). CONCLUSION: For patients with localized CRC, high vitamin D levels before resection were associated with reduced risk of high inflammatory biomarkers for younger patients and reduced risk of major postoperative complications for older patients. Vitamin D deficiency was associated with reduced survival regardless of age.

ABSTRACT

INTRODUCTION: The incidence of colorectal cancer (CRC) increases with age. In combination with an ageing population, the number of older patients undergoing surgical treatment for CRC is therefore expected to increase. Sarcopenia and cachexia are potentially modifiable risk factors of a negative surgical outcome. Sarcopenia can be categorized into primary (age-related) and secondary where diseases, such as malignancy, are influential factors. We aimed to investigate the prevalence of preoperative sarcopenia and cachexia in older (≥65 years) vulnerable patients with localized CRC. MATERIALS AND METHODS: Patients included in the randomized study "Geriatric assessment and intervention in older vulnerable patients undergoing resection for colorectal cancer," were screened for sarcopenia and cachexia prior to surgery. All patients in the present cohort were considered vulnerable with Geriatric 8 ≤ 14 points. Sarcopenia was defined according to European Guidelines (EWGSOP2), based on low muscle strength-low handgrip-strength and/or slow 5xChair-Stand-Test-and low appendicular lean mass assessed by dual-energy X-ray absorptiometry. Cachexia was defined as self-reported unintended weight loss >5% within three months or 2-5% with body mass index <20 kg/m2. RESULTS: Sixty-four patients (mean age 79.6 years ±6.4 years, 36 women) were assessed. Of these, 28% (n = 18, 11 women) had low muscle strength and 13% (n = 8, 4 women) fulfilled the criteria for sarcopenia, however, 33% (n = 21, 13 women) had low muscle mass. There was no correlation between low muscle strength and low muscle mass (r = 0.16, P = 0.22). The prevalence of cachexia was 36% (n = 23, 16 women). Low muscle mass was associated with cachexia (φ = 0.38, P = 0.005), but there was no association between sarcopenia and cachexia (φ = 0.01, P = 1.0). DISCUSSION: Despite the included patients who fulfilled the criteria for vulnerability according to G8, relatively few (28%) had low muscle strength. Moreover, there was poor overlap between the prevalence of sarcopenia according to the EWGSOP2 guidelines (13%) and prevalence of low muscle mass (33%) in older patients with CRC. Of note also, there was no association between sarcopenia and cachexia, but an association between cachexia and low muscle mass, which highlights the importance of assessing muscle mass in patients with cancer. TRIAL REGISTRATION: The GEPOC trial has been prospectively registered at http://clinicaltrials.gov (NCT03719573).

ABSTRACT

INTRODUCTION: Older and frail patients with cancer are at high risk of physical and functional decline during chemotherapy. Exercise interventions can often counteract chemotherapy related toxicity and may help patients to improve or retain physical function and quality of life. Studies evaluating feasibility and the effect of exercise in older patients are lacking. The aim of this study was to investigate the feasibility and effect of an exercise intervention in older frail patients during chemotherapy for colorectal cancer (CRC). MATERIALS AND METHODS: This is a secondary analysis from the GERICO study investigating the effect of geriatric interventions in frail patients ≥70 years receiving chemotherapy for CRC. All patients in the present analysis were patients randomized to geriatric interventions and who were found physically frail (low handgrip strength or slow 10 m gait speed) and therefore offered referral to the exercise program for twelve weeks. We evaluated reasons for dropping out and feasibility of an individually tailored exercise program twice a week for twelve weeks. Each 60 min session comprised warm-up followed by progressive resistance training and cool-down followed by an oral protein supplement. Baseline characteristics and the effect of exercise for patients with high and low adherence (attendance of <50% of exercise sessions) were compared. RESULTS: Of 71 patients in the intervention group, 47 (66%) were found physically frail and were offered referral to the exercise program. Seven patients were referred to municipal physiotherapy before study start. In the remaining population (N = 40) 19 had exercise adherence >50% and 21 had no or low exercise adherence. Baseline characteristics were similar between patients with high and low/no adherence, except for sex (68% and 33% were men in high and low/ no adherence group, respectively). Patients with >50% attendance had significant improvements in physical tests after twelve weeks of exercise. DISCUSSION: Low adherence to the exercise program was seen due to lack of energy and/or treatment related adverse events. Patients with high adherence benefitted from exercise during chemotherapy but did not differ from patients with low adherence at baseline. Consequently, exercise should be offered to all older frail patients receiving chemotherapy for CRC.

ABSTRACT

Background: Patients with bladder cancer (BC) have a high prevalence of comorbidity and low adherence to systemic anticancer treatment but it is unknown whether this is associated with sarcopenia. Objective: We aimed to investigate if the sarcopenia-defining parameters (muscle strength, muscle mass and physical performance) were associated with reduced adherence to systemic anticancer treatment in patients with BC, and if these muscle domains changed during treatment. Methods: Patients >18 years of age with BC referred for chemotherapy or immunotherapy at Department of Oncology, Rigshospitalet, Denmark were eligible for study inclusion. Measurements were performed before treatment initiation and within one week after treatment termination, and consisted of assessments of muscle strength, muscle mass, and physical performance. Data was compared with thresholds outlined by the European Working Group on Sarcopenia in Older Patient's (EWGSOP2) guidelines and a healthy, age-matched Danish cohort. Results: Over a period of 29 months, we included 14 patients of whom two completed follow-up measurements. The recruitment rate was <50% of planned due to logistics and Covid-19 related limitations. Consequently, a decision to prematurely terminate the study was made. No patients fulfilled EWGSOP2 criteria for sarcopenia, but the majority had reduction in one or more muscle domains compared to healthy, age-matched individuals. The majority of patients had poor treatment tolerance, leading to dose reductions and postponed treatments. Conclusions: In this prematurely terminated study, no patients fulfilled EWGSOP2 criteria for sarcopenia, yet, most patients were affected in one or more muscle domains and the majority had compromised treatment adherence.

ABSTRACT

BACKGROUND: Effects of exercise in patients with breast cancer have been thoroughly investigated. The aim was to explore differences in effects regarding type, delivery mode and extensiveness (e.g. intensity; volume) of the interventions. METHODS: We searched for randomised controlled trials including patients with breast cancer receiving systemic treatment, exercise-based interventions, and measures on patient reported- and objectively measured outcomes. RESULTS: Exercise showed significant and moderate effects on the primary outcomes quality of life and physical function, Standardised Mean Difference: 0.52 (95 % CI 0.38-0.65) and 0.52 (95 % CI 0.38-0.66), respectively. Type of exercise had little influence on the effects, however combined aerobic- and resistance exercise seemed superior for increasing physical function, compared to aerobic or resistance exercise. Supervised interventions were superior to partly and unsupervised. Extensiveness of the intervention only influenced physical function. CONCLUSIONS: Supervised interventions, more than type or extensiveness of interventions, seem to increase effects.

ABSTRACT

BACKGROUND: The proportion of patients with locally advanced, unresectable or metastatic urothelial carcinoma that do not receive systemic anticancer treatment and the reasons for lack of treatment are largely unknown. The aim of this study was to investigate the prevalence and overall survival of this patient group and reasons for omission of treatment. MATERIAL AND METHODS: This retrospective, single-center cohort study from Rigshospitalet, Denmark included patients diagnosed with locally advanced, unresectable or metastatic urothelial carcinoma during the study period from 1 January 2010 to 31 March 2016 who did not receive systemic anticancer treatment. Patients were identified through the Danish Pathology Register and the electronic medical records. RESULTS: 100 patients were included, representing 34% of all patients diagnosed with locally advanced, unresectable or metastatic urothelial carcinoma at Rigshospitalet during the study period. Lack of treatment was most often due to poor physical condition (59%), decreased renal function (15%), or patient preferences (14%). Median overall survival was 1.9 months (95% CI: 1.6-2.8 months). CONCLUSION: One in three patients diagnosed with locally advanced, unresectable or metastatic urothelial carcinoma in the pre-immunotherapy era did not receive systemic anticancer treatment. Prompt identification of advanced disease and interventions to optimize these patients for treatment are essential. Our findings underscore the compelling need for novel, better tolerated treatment regimens in this frail patient group.

ABSTRACT

AIM: The aim of this systematic review is to summarize all available data on the effect of a geriatric assessment in older patients with cancer, for oncologic treatment decisions, the implementation of non-oncologic interventions, patient-doctor communication, and treatment outcome. Additionally, we examined the impact of the type of assessment used. METHODS: Systematic Medline and Embase search for studies on the effect of a geriatric assessment on oncologic treatment decisions, non-oncologic interventions, communication, and outcome. RESULTS: Sixty-five publications from 61 studies were included. After a geriatric assessment, the oncologic treatment plan was altered in a median of 31% of patients (range 7-56%), with highest change rates in studies using a multidisciplinary team evaluation. Non-oncologic interventions were recommended in over 70% of patients, provided that an intervention plan or specific expertise was in place. A geriatric assessment led to more goals-of-care discussions and improved communication. The geriatric assessment also led to lower toxicity/complication rates (most strongly if the assessment outcomes were considered during decision making), improved likelihood of treatment completion, and improved physical functioning and quality of life in the majority of included studies. CONCLUSION: A geriatric assessment can change oncologic treatment plans, leads to non-oncologic interventions, and improve communication about care planning and ageing-related issues. It can decrease toxicity/complications and improve treatment completion and patient-centred outcomes. If multidisciplinary or geriatric input is not available, having a pre-defined non-oncologic intervention plan is important. To maximize the effect on outcomes, the result of the geriatric assessment should be incorporated into oncologic decision-making.

ABSTRACT

BACKGROUND: To prevent severe toxicity and hospital admissions, adequate management and recall of information about side effects are crucial and health literacy plays an important role. If age-related factors impact recall of given information and handling of side effects, revised ways to give information are required. PATIENTS AND METHODS: We undertook a questionnaire-based survey among 188 newly diagnosed patients with pancreatic cancer or colorectal cancer and chemo-naive patients with prostate cancer treated with adjuvant or first-line palliative chemotherapy comprising satisfaction with given information, recall of potential side effects, and handling of hypothetical side effect scenarios. We evaluated the association between baseline characteristics, ie, age, frailty (G8 score), comorbidity (Charlson Comorbidity Index), cognitive function (Mini-Cog), satisfaction, recall of information, and handling of side effects. RESULTS: Reduced ability to recall information about several side effects (eg, chest pain) was associated with older age (odds ratio adjusted for cancer [aOR] 0.94 [95% CI, 0.88-0.98]) and poor cognitive screening (aOR 0.56 [95% CI, 0.33-0.91]). Insufficient or dangerous handling of side effects was associated with older age (aOR 0.96 (95% CI, 0.92-0.99)) and cognitive impairment (aOR 0.70 [95% CI, 0.50-0.95]). CONCLUSION: Older age and poor cognitive screening may impact patients' ability to understand and adequately handle chemotherapy-related side effects. Cognitive screening and focus on individual ways to give information including assessment of recall and handling are needed.

ABSTRACT

BACKGROUND: Sparse evidence exists regarding the feasibility and patients' experiences of exercise programs among older cancer populations. OBJECTIVE: The aim of this study was to explore the experiences of older patients with advanced cancer who participated in a 12-week supervised and multimodal exercise program in a hospital setting. METHODS: Individual interviews were conducted with 18 participants (≥65 years) with advanced cancer who completed the intervention program regardless of compliance rate. In addition, written evaluation questionnaires were collected. Data were analyzed using thematic analysis. RESULTS: Three main themes were identified: (1) Motivated to strengthen body and mind, with the subthemes "Doing what only I can do" and "Reaching goals with support from healthcare professionals and peers"; (2) Exercise as an integrated part of the treatment course; and (3) Overcoming undeniable physical limitations. CONCLUSIONS: The participants experienced several benefits from participation, including physical improvements, increased energy, reduction of symptoms, and improved social engagement. Goal setting, being positively pushed and cheered on, and integration of fun games increased motivation. In contrast, being pushed beyond physical limitations and experiencing severe symptoms were experienced as barriers toward exercising. Adherence to the exercise program was facilitated by coordinating a tailored program with medical appointments and receiving comprehensive support and guidance. IMPLICATIONS FOR PRACTICE: Multimodal exercise programs seem to be beneficial for older patients with advanced cancer and should be coordinated with oncological treatment in combination with targeted support and advice on symptom management.

ABSTRACT

INTRODUCTION: Comprehensive geriatric assessment (CGA) has been shown to reduce frailty in older patients in general. In older patients with cancer, frailty affects quality of life (QoL), physical function, and survival. However, few studies have examined the effect of CGA as an additional intervention to antineoplastic treatment. This protocol presents a randomized controlled trial, which aims to evaluate the effects of CGA-based interventions in older patients with cancer and Geriatric 8 (G8) identified frailty. MATERIALS AND METHODS: This randomized controlled trial will include patients, age 70+ years, with solid malignancies and G8 frailty (G8 ≤ 14). Patients will be separated into two groups, with different primary endpoints, depending on palliative or curative antineoplastic treatment initiation, and subsequently randomized 1:1 to either CGA with corresponding interventions or standard of care, along with standardized antineoplastic treatment. A geriatrician led CGA with corresponding interventions and clinical follow-up will be conducted within one month of antineoplastic treatment initiation. The interdisciplinary CGA will cover multiple geriatric domains and employ a standard set of validated assessment tools. Primary endpoints will be physical decline measured with the 30-s Chair-Stand-Test at three months (palliative setting) and unplanned hospital admissions at six months (curative setting). Additional outcomes include QoL, treatment toxicity and adherence, occurrence of polypharmacy, potential drug interactions, potential inappropriate medications, and survival. The primary outcomes will be analyzed using a mixed model regression analysis (30-s chair stand test) and linear regression models (unplanned hospitalizations), with an intention to treat approach. Power calculations reveal the need to enroll 134 (palliative) and 188 (curative) patients. DISCUSSION: The present study will examine whether CGA, as an additional intervention to antineoplastic treatment, can improve endpoints valued by older patients with cancer. Inclusion began November 2020 and is ongoing, with 37 and 29 patients recruited April 15th, 2021. Registration:NCT04686851.

ABSTRACT

BACKGROUND: Older patients with cancer are at risk of physical decline and impaired quality of life during oncological treatment. Exercise training has the potential to reduce these challenges. The study aim was to investigate the feasibility and effect of a multimodal exercise intervention in older patients with advanced cancer (stages III/IV). PATIENTS AND METHODS: Eighty-four older adults (≥65 years) with advanced pancreatic, biliary tract, or non-small cell lung cancer who received systemic oncological treatment were randomized 1:1 to an intervention group or a control group. The intervention was a 12-week multimodal exercise-based program including supervised exercise twice weekly followed by a protein supplement, a home-based walking program, and nurse-led support and counseling. The primary endpoint was change in physical function (30-second chair stand test) at 13 weeks. RESULTS: Median age of the participants was 72 years (interquartile range [IQR] 68-75). Median adherence to the exercise sessions was 69% (IQR 21-88) and 75% (IQR 33-100) for the walking program. At 13 weeks, there was a significant difference in change scores of 2.4 repetitions in the chair stand test, favoring the intervention group (p < .0001). Furthermore, significant beneficial effects were seen for physical endurance (6-minute walk test), hand grip strength, physical activity, symptom burden, symptoms of depression and anxiety, global health status (quality of life), and lean body mass. No effects were seen for dose intensity, hospitalizations, or survival. CONCLUSION: A 12-week multimodal exercise intervention with targeted support proved effective in improving physical function in older patients with advanced cancer during oncological treatment.

ABSTRACT

INTRODUCTION: Older patients with cancer constitute a heterogeneous group with varying degrees of frailty; therefore, geriatric assessment with initial geriatric oncology screening is recommended. The Geriatric 8 (G8) and the modified Geriatric 8 (mG8) are promising screening tools with high accuracy and an association with survival. However, evidence is sparse regarding patient-centered outcomes. This protocol describes a study, which aims to address the predictive and prognostic value of the G8 and mG8, with quality of life (QoL) as the primary outcome. MATERIALS AND METHODS: In this single-center prospective cohort study, patients, age ≥70 years with solid malignancies, will be screened with the G8 and mG8 prior to receiving 1st line antineoplastic treatment. Patients will contribute medical record data including; cancer type, Charlson comorbidity index score, performance status, and treatment intent, type, and dosage, at baseline. Patients will complete QoL questionnaires (EORTC QLQ-C30 and ELD-14) at baseline, 3, 6, 9, and 12-months follow-up. Two functional measurements (the 30-s chair stand test and the handgrip strength test) will be conducted at baseline to assess the added predictive and prognostic value. At 12 months follow-up, initially administered treatment and treatment adherence will be recorded and assessed with generalized linear models, while overall survival and cancer-specific survival will be assessed using survival analysis models with time-varying covariates. The relationship between frailty (G8 ≤ 14, mG8 ≥ 6) and QoL within 12 months will be examined using mixed regression models. DISCUSSION: Geriatric oncology screening may identify a subgroup of older patients with frailty, at risk of experiencing diminishing QoL and poor treatment adherence. With the proposed screening program, patients who require treatment modification and additional support to maintain their QoL may be identified. It is our hope, that these insights may facilitate the formation of national guidelines for the treatment of older patients with cancer. Registration:NCT04644874.

ABSTRACT

BACKGROUND: Older patients with colorectal cancer (CRC) experience chemotherapy dose reductions or discontinuation. Comprehensive geriatric assessment (CGA) predicts survival and chemotherapy completion in patients with cancer, but the benefit of geriatric interventions remains unexplored. METHODS: The GERICO study is a randomised Phase 3 trial including patients ≥70 years receiving adjuvant or first-line palliative chemotherapy for CRC. Vulnerable patients (G8 questionnaire ≤14 points) were randomised 1:1 to CGA-based interventions or standard care, along with guideline-based chemotherapy. The primary outcome was chemotherapy completion without dose reductions or delays. Secondary outcomes were toxicity, survival and quality of life (QoL). RESULTS: Of 142 patients, 58% received adjuvant and 42% received first-line palliative chemotherapy. Interventions included medication changes (62%), nutritional therapy (51%) and physiotherapy (39%). More interventional patients completed scheduled chemotherapy compared with controls (45% vs. 28%, P = 0.0366). Severe toxicity occurred in 39% of controls and 28% of interventional patients (P = 0.156). QoL improved in interventional patients compared with controls with the decreased burden of illness (P = 0.048) and improved mobility (P = 0.008). CONCLUSION: Geriatric interventions compared with standard care increased the number of older, vulnerable patients with CRC completing adjuvant chemotherapy, and may improve the burden of illness and mobility. TRIAL REGISTRATION: ClinicalTrials.gov ID: NCT02748811.

ABSTRACT

BACKGROUND: The incidence of colorectal cancer (CRC) increases with age. Older patients are a heterogeneous group ranging from fit to frail with various comorbidities. Frail older patients with CRC are at increased risk of negative outcomes and functional decline after cancer surgery compared to younger and fit older patients. Maintenance of independence after treatment is rarely investigated in clinical trials despite older patients value it as high as survival. Comprehensive geriatric assessment (CGA) is an evaluation of an older persons' medical, psychosocial, and functional capabilities to develop an overall plan for treatment and follow-up. The beneficial effect of CGA is well documented in the fields of medicine and orthopaedic surgery, but evidence is lacking in cancer surgery. We aim to investigate the effect of CGA on physical performance in older frail patients undergoing surgery for CRC. METHODS: GEPOC is a single centre randomised controlled trial including older patients (≥65 years) undergoing surgical resection for primary CRC. Frail patients (≤14/17 points using the G8 screening tool) will be randomised 1:1 to geriatric intervention and exercise (n = 50) or standard of care along (n = 50) with their standard surgical procedure. Intervention includes preoperative CGA, perioperative geriatric in-ward review and postoperative follow-up. All patients in the intervention group will participate in a pre- and postoperative resistance exercise programme (twice/week, 2 + 12 weeks). Primary endpoint is change in 30-s chair stand test. Assessment of primary endpoint will be performed by physiotherapists blinded to patient allocation. Secondary endpoints: changes in health related quality of life, physical strength and capacity (handgrip strength, gait speed and 6 min walking test), patient perceived quality of recovery, complications to surgery, body composition (Dual-energy X-ray absorptiometry and bioelectric impedance), serum biomarkers, readmission, length of stay and survival. DISCUSSION: This ongoing trial will provide valuable knowledge on whether preoperative CGA and postoperative geriatric follow-up and intervention including an exercise program can counteract physical decline and improve quality of life in frail CRC patients undergoing surgery. TRIAL REGISTRATION: Prospectively registered at Clinicaltrials.gov NCT03719573 (October 2018).

ABSTRACT

BACKGROUND: COVID-19, caused by the Severe Acute Respiratory Syndrome Coronavirus 2 (SARS-CoV-2), has great health implications in older patients, including high mortality. In general, older patients often have atypical symptom presentations during acute illness due to a high level of comorbidity. The purpose of this study was to investigate the presentation of symptoms at hospital admissions in older patients with COVID-19 and evaluate its impact on disease outcome. METHODS: This retrospective study included patients ≥80 years of age with a positive test for SARS-CoV-2, who were admitted to one of three medical departments in Denmark from March 1st to June 1st, 2020. RESULTS: A total of 102 patients (47% male) with a mean age of 85 years were included. The most common symptoms at admission were fever (74%), cough (62%), and shortness of breath (54%). Furthermore, atypical symptoms like confusion (29%), difficulty walking (13%), and falls (8%) were also present. In-hospital and 30-day mortality were 31% (n = 32) and 41% (n = 42), respectively. Mortality was highest in patients with confusion (50% vs 38%) or falls (63% vs 39%), and nursing home residency prior to hospital admission was associated with higher mortality (OR 2.7, 95% CI 1.1-6.7). CONCLUSIONS: Older patients with SARS-Cov-2 displayed classical symptoms of COVID-19 but also geriatric frailty symptoms such as confusion and walking impairments. Additionally, both in-hospital and 30-day mortality was very high. Our study highlights the need for preventive efforts to keep older people from getting COVID-19 and increased awareness of frailty among those with COVID-19.
